分割GAE背景线程Python的日志记录

时间:2013-12-03 08:55:02

标签: google-app-engine python-2.7

我在Google App Engine上以Python的形式运行了几个后台线程作为单独的模块。他们每人都有一个主循环,他们做了一些工作,睡觉,然后再做一些工作。我遇到的问题是,他们的所有日志记录都会在“日志”视图中的单个“/ _ah / background”块中结束,过了一段时间后,无法扩展该记录。最近的日志行也在底部,但我可以忍受......

如何告诉记录器(或查看者)拆分记录(好像它已收到新请求)?

1 个答案:

答案 0 :(得分:0)

您可以use logging.flush()manually flush log messages,它们会显示在新的日志记录中。您还可以在给定的时间,数据或日志行之后配置日志记录到automatically flush